Per Curiam.

{¶ 1} We affirm the judgment of the court of appeals dismissing the petition of Appellant, Stephen M. Lester, for writs of mandamus and procedendo to compel appellee, Auglaize County Common Pleas Court Judge Frederick D. Pepple, to issue a final and appealable sentencing entry in his criminal case.
